K856 NKC is a 1993 Fiat Uno in Blue with a 999c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 1993 Fiat Uno models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.3% with a typical mileage of 70,149 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Fiat Uno f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 5,579 recorded failures. If you're considering buying K856 NKC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Uno typ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 33 years old, this Fiat Uno is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
